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Jalankan kueri mentah pada Konektor Loopback MySQL

Berikut adalah contoh dasar. Jika Anda memiliki model Produk (/common/models/product.json), perluas model dengan menambahkan file /common/models/product.js:

module.exports = function(Product) {

    Product.byCategory = function (category, cb) {

        var ds = Product.dataSource;
        var sql = "SELECT * FROM products WHERE category=?";

        ds.connector.query(sql, category, function (err, products) {

            if (err) console.error(err);

            cb(err, products);

        });

    };

    Product.remoteMethod(
        'byCategory',
        {
            http: { verb: 'get' },
            description: 'Get list of products by category',
            accepts: { arg: 'category', type: 'string' },
            returns: { arg: 'data', type: ['Product'], root: true }
        }
    );

};

Ini akan membuat contoh titik akhir berikut:GET /Products/byCategory?group=computers

http://docs.strongloop.com/display/public/LB /Mengeksekusi+asli+SQL



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cara Terbaik untuk Memperbaiki Tabel InnoDB yang Rusak di MySQL

  2. Perlu untuk menghubungkan IDX MLS ke dalam situs web

  3. Array Mysql Tidak Bekerja

  4. Membuat situs berbagi video, membutuhkan pemutar video

  5. Coba lagi kebuntuan ActiveRecord3